Phone or video sessions focus on identifying important life areas and personal values that are vital to a rich and meaningful life, as well as the thoughts and feelings that tend to get in the way of taking steps towards such a life. Mindfulness and compassion training is then used to help understand inner obstacles and to change the relationship with problematic thoughts and feelings so that they no longer get in the way of valued living.

Burnaby is one of Metro Vancouver's most populous municipalities — home to Simon Fraser University and BCIT, and housing the headquarters of Electronic Arts Canada, Telus, and other major technology companies — creating a therapy demand shaped by tech-sector burnout, academic stress, and a highly multicultural population that includes large Chinese, South Korean, Iranian, and South Asian communities. SFU and BCIT generate significant student mental health demand and clinical training pipelines that feed into the local therapy community. Burnaby Hospital and Royal Columbian Hospital provide institutional mental health resources alongside a growing private practice community that serves residents increasingly priced out of Vancouver proper. Many Burnaby residents access the broader Metro Vancouver therapy ecosystem, and the relative proximity to Vancouver means specialist care is generally accessible.
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) therapists in Burnaby, British Columbia, Canada Statistics
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) therapists in Burnaby, British Columbia, Canada average 7 years of experience and charge around $163 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The most commonly treated issues are Anxiety or Fears (85%), Depression (75%), and Stress (74%).
